免费测试

为什么短信验证码是6位数字


时间:2018-11-23 01:24:46 | 来自:巴卜小编 | 浏览次数:970


如果有留意就会发现我们收到的短信验证码都是6为数字,为什么短信验证码是6位数字而不是其他位数呢,这其实跟安全和体验问题有关系。本文巴卜小编就具体给大家解释下为什么短信验证码是6位数字。

为什么短信验证码是6位数字

短信验证码是6位数的原因之一:因为四位数验证的安全性没有六位高。

四位数的验证数字还是很容易被猜到或是被破解的,有人做了统计计算,四位验证信息有1/10000=0.01%的概率被猜中,而六位的则只有1/1000000=0.0001%的概率,如果再将时间限制、次数限制、IP限制等条件去除以后,一个4位数的验证码可能会在5分钟内被破解,但是六位数的则没有那么容易。所以,现在的验证码一般都是6位而不是4位。

短信验证码是6位数的原因之二:是因为考虑到记忆的方便性。

6位数的验证码短信数字可以分成2/2/2或者3/3来方便记忆,跟人们的一些记忆习惯很相符,若是5位的分成2/3来记忆,不方便还容易出错。

短信验证码是6位数的原因之三:综合考虑

从安全破解的层面来讲,一般比较常用到的方法就是暴力破解,常常都是通过字符进行数字排列组合,再进行一个一个的对比,直到成功为止。按道理来讲,位数越长的验证码越难破解,安全性也更高,但是不利于用户记忆,也不方便操作,所以通常情况下选择了比较适合的6位。

验证码短信虽然只有6位数,可安全性是有目共睹的,再加上一些安全防范措施,一般情况很难出现被破解的情况,保护了用户的帐号安全,也让企业更好的管理,所以在银行、金融、教育等各个行业当中均有应用。

短信验证码的作用

对网站平台:短信验证码的作用是为了网站安全利益最大化,防止不法分子利用作弊器进行恶意注册、发垃圾信息和大量登录,所以采用短信验证码的方式对网站进行保护。

对普通用户:短信验证码的使用有效提高了用户账户安全性,是电子商务、行业网站不可或缺的重要一环。优质的短信验证码对于提升用户体验更是具有不可替代的作用。

本文主要给大家介绍了短信验证码字数的问题,通过小编的讲解大家应该知道为什么短信验证码是6位数字了吧,这不是随便定的,而是科学依据的。当然作为普通用户来说对于短信验证码的字数不用太过关注,只要注意保管好自己的短信验证码就行。



短信新闻文章

短信平台在线咨询
短信平台服务热线
短信平台在线QQ咨询
关注微信

 

立即免费试用

2014-现在 ibabo.cn,All Rights Reserved.巴卜通信 版权所有 京ICP备15050983号-1

北京巴卜短信群发平台免费提供企业短信,短信接口验证码短信测试及会员短信营销服务,短信验证码速度快、到达率高、稳定性强。